日期:2023-10-12 阅读量:0次 所属栏目:论文百科
数据库并发控制论文涵盖的领域包括:
1. 事务管理:研究如何管理并发执行的事务,确保数据的一致性和隔离性。例如,论文可以探讨并发控制算法的性能比较,如乐观并发控制和悲观并发控制。
2. 锁管理:研究如何使用锁进行并发控制,保护共享数据的访问。例如,论文可以研究不同类型的锁,如共享锁和排他锁的性能比较。
3. 并发控制算法:研究并发控制算法的设计和优化。例如,论文可以介绍新的并发控制算法,如基于时间戳的并发控制算法或多版本并发控制算法。
4. 多版本控制:研究如何利用多个版本的数据实现并发控制。例如,论文可以研究不同的多版本控制策略,如基于时间戳的多版本控制或快照隔离级别的多版本控制。
5. 并发度调度:研究如何调度并发执行的操作,以提高数据库的性能。例如,论文可以研究调度算法,在考虑并发控制的同时最大限度地减少冲突。
6. 死锁检测与解决:研究如何检测和解决并发执行中的死锁问题。例如,论文可以介绍不同的死锁检测算法,如图算法或资源加权算法,以及死锁解决算法,如抢占、回滚或等待。
7. 分布式并发控制:研究如何处理分布式系统中的并发控制问题。例如,论文可以研究分布式锁的设计和实现,以及分布式事务的隔离性保证。
8. 数据库复制:研究如何实现并发控制在数据复制场景下的应用。例如,论文可以研究不同的数据复制策略,如主备复制或多主复制,并考虑并发控制的需求。
9. 优化并发控制性能:研究如何优化并发控制算法和策略,以提高数据库系统的性能。例如,论文可以研究如何通过调整并发控制机制的参数来提高性能,或者如何使用并行计算技术来加速并发控制的执行。
这些是数据库并发控制论文涵盖的常见领域,每个领域都有很多具体的研究方向和方法。根据具体的研究兴趣和问题,可以深入探索其中的某个领域。